WebBefore i do dishes, i take the sponge and wet it and add a few drops of soap. Wring out 60% of the water and microwave for 1 min, it will be steaming hot so be careful. The sponge stinks because of bacteria growth and microwaving sterilizes it to a degree. 18. level 2. · … WebJun 25, 2024 · Once boiling add 1 cup of white vinegar. Add the dishcloths. Boil for about 20 minutes, stirring around with a spoon every now and then. Turn the stove off and let the cloths cool. Hang to dry. And that’s all there is to it. That is how you stop your dish towels and dishrags from smelling so bad.
